I have redesigned my original to include the longer line on the bottom of the C to come closer to the wheel hub & extended the inner negative stripes to match the pics. Also changed the front tip to a half bullet nose. Contemplated copying the "type3" as it is in the pic but I think these would have been hand cut originally so this would explain the variations between the brochure & the final product so i'm sticking with my original with some minor tweaks.

make sure you wait a while like a month before applying it on fresh paint.

adhering things to new paint can and often does cause issues with the paint underneath. Luckily with VWs there isn't anything thats adhered to the paint except for this exception.
